4664.0330 INPATIENT CARE.
§
Subpart 1.
Short-term inpatient care.
A hospice provider must ensure that inpatient care is available for pain control, symptom management, and respite purposes and is provided in a licensed hospital, a nursing home, or a residential hospice facility. Inpatient care must be provided directly or under arrangement with one or more hospitals, nursing homes, or residential hospice facilities.
